The Dow did hit about 15 PE (as I calculated it at the time) last October. Bad bear market often ends up much lower, but with interest rates as low as they are, the same rule may not apply. For instance the PE at the low in August 1982 was around 7 or so, but treasuries were at 13% to 16% at that time, so compared to returns in safe instruments, people make the argument that the 1982 PE of 7 was really a PE of 15 or so relative to the long term rates.
